The Philosophy Behind a Comprehensive Prayer Template

The foundation of a "pray about everything" approach lies in the understanding that no concern is too trivial or too immense for reflection. This philosophy rejects the notion that prayer should be reserved only for emergencies or grand celebrations. Instead, it embraces the full spectrum of human experience—joy, frustration, anticipation, and grief—as valid entry points for dialogue. By adopting a consistent template, individuals cultivate a habit of mindfulness, ensuring that gratitude, repentance, and supplication are woven into the fabric of daily life.

Practical Application and Daily Integration

Integrating this method into a busy schedule requires simplicity and accessibility. The goal is not to add another task to an overflowing to-do list, but to transform existing moments—such as a morning commute or a quiet evening pause—into opportunities for grounding. By following a clear sequence, individuals can quickly center themselves without requiring special tools or extended time.
| Focus Area | Purpose | Practical Prompt |
|---|---|---|
| Gratitude | Shifts attention to abundance | Name three specific blessings from the last 24 hours |
| Confession | Creates emotional honesty | Acknowledge one area where you fell short |
| Intercession | Expands compassion beyond self | Lift one person or situation you tend to overlook |
| Supplication | Clarifies personal needs | Ask for guidance on one current decision or challenge |
Overcoming Mental Resistance

Despite its simplicity, adopting this consistent reflective practice can initially feel uncomfortable. The mind may resist stillness, or skepticism may question the effectiveness of structured prayer. These responses are natural, yet they can be gently addressed by lowering expectations and focusing on consistency over intensity. Starting with brief, five-minute sessions reduces the barrier to entry and allows the habit to grow organically.
